1. Get Started: Click the "Spin" button to set the canvas in motion. Watch it rotate and prepare to create! When you’re ready to pause and refine your work, simply hit "Stop."
2. Customize Your Brush: Tailor your experience by adjusting the "Brush Size" for bold or delicate strokes, tweaking "Opacity" for subtle or vivid effects, and setting the "Spin Speed" to control the rhythm of your patterns—slow for precision, fast for dynamic flair.
3. Create Your Art: Click and hold anywhere on the spinning canvas to paint. As it rotates, your strokes transform into captivating circular patterns. Experiment with different movements and timings to discover endless design possibilities.
4. Perfect Your Work: Made a mistake? Use the "Undo" button to step back, or "Redo" to bring an idea back to life. These tools give you the freedom to refine your masterpiece without starting over.
5. Share Your Creation: Once you’re satisfied with your artwork, click "Export" to save it as a high-quality PNG file. Share it with friends, post it online, or print it to display your SpinBrush talent!
